Chapter 3
Compex WLU108G Installation
Atheros Client Utility (ACU) and Supplicant option
Select this option to install your WLU108G utility. (Recommended)
Third Party Supplicant option
Select this option if you decide to use Wireless Zero Configuration
Utility to configure your wireless device. Installing this tool will only
allow you to view the status of the connected wireless device/s
through the WLU108G utility; configuration using the WLU108G utility
will not be allowed.
Third Party Supplicant option (continued..)
If you have selected Third Party Supplicant configuration tool, a
screen similar to that on the right will appear, prompting you to
enable/disable the system tray icon.
9.
Click on the checkbox besides
Enable Atheros System Tray Utility
and click on the Next> button to
proceed.
10.
The screen below appears to inform you that the driver will be
automatically installed if you have already inserted your client
adapter into the USB slot of your computer.
Cancel the Found New Hardware Wizard if it appears and click on
the OK button to begin the installation.
